Quality Technician Level I/II

Be Part of the Team Behind Reliable Medical Equipment

Pay Rate: $22/hour

Are you detail-oriented and looking for a hands‑on role where your work makes a real difference? As a Quality Technician, you'll help ensure critical medical equipment is clean, inspected, tested, maintained, repaired, accurately inventoried, and ready when healthcare customers need it. With opportunities at Level I and II this role offers room to build your technical expertise, take on greater responsibility, and grow into a leadership role.

What You’ll Do
  • Prepare medical equipment for customers by cleaning, maintaining, decontaminating, inspecting, and performing basic function testing.
  • Identify equipment requiring repair, properly tag units, and coordinate repairs with internal teams, customers, and Field Service Engineers.
  • At higher levels, troubleshoot, diagnose, adjust, maintain, and repair electronic medical equipment.
  • Ensure equipment barcodes, inventory records, inspection updates, and documentation are accurate and up to date.
  • Coordinate receiving, shipping, inventory allocation, and track-and-trace activities while ensuring customer ship dates are met.
  • Conduct physical inventory counts, cycle counts, and parts management activities.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and efficient warehouse environment.
  • Communicate with customers, Sales Representatives, hospital representatives, and internal teams regarding equipment availability, repairs, and inventory.
  • Assist with tradeshow staging, on‑site training, and customer support activities.
  • At Level III, help coordinate daily team workload, train junior personnel, and provide performance feedback to management.
  • Support inventory reporting, month‑end processes, and other operational projects as needed.
  • Serve as a trusted point of escalation for equipment and customer issues at higher technician levels.
